CORRECTION

Rosemond is the 109th gun-related case heard by the U.S. Supreme Court, NOT the 111th, as I incorrectly stated in Page Nine No. 133. Ooops. Sorry. Here's the order of the Supreme Court's gun cases, occurring after the list of 107 on our website https://www.gunlaws.com/supreme.htm

108 Salinas v. Texas No. 12-246, 6/17/13
109 Rosemond v. United States, No. 12-895, 3/5/14
110 United States v. Castleman, No. 12-1371 3/26/14
111 Abramski v. United States No. 12-1493 Pending

3- Gun Business Is Booming, the economy, not so much


The lamestream media told you:
The lamestream media told you:

The economy is bleak, the recovery is slow, unemployment is up, it's republicans' fault, government is focused on creating jobs, our statistics for counting unemployment is beyond reproach, despite all the accounting tricks revealed lately (like not counting out-of-work people who have given up, now there's a trick!), and the outlook is bleak.



The Uninvited Ombudsman notes however that:
The Uninvited Ombudsman notes however that:

The National Shooting Sports Foundation reported that the March 2014 NSSF-adjusted National Instant Criminal Background Check System (NICS) figure of 1,224,705 is the second highest March on record for the system, even with a decrease of 18.4% compared to the March 2013 NSSF-adjusted NICS figure of 1,501,730.

For comparison, the unadjusted March 2014 NICS figure of 2,476,610 reflects a 12.7% increase from the unadjusted NICS figure of 2,197,116 in March 2013.

The unusually large difference in the NSSF-adjusted and unadjusted NICS numbers appears to be due to the re-submission by North Carolina of monthly background checks for CCW permits. (They re-submit their permitees each month to make sure none have fallen into a prohibited category, expensive and time consuming. No figures are available on if this accomplishes anything, or creates harm.) Other factors are known to vary the NICS numbers from an actual count of guns purchased, including multiple purchases at one time, decision not to buy, denials, delays, official uses of NICS for other purposes, etc.

4- No Gun Bills Pre-Election

Not Enough Senate Votes To Pass Anything

NSSF reports that U.S. Senate Majority Leader Harry Reid (D-Nev.) has said that any legislation to expand the current National Instant Criminal Background Check System (NICS) will not be considered on the Senate floor following Wednesday's shooting involving an apparently mentally unstable soldier at Fort Hood in Texas.

While Reid pledged last year to bring gun-control legislation back to the floor, he said there are insufficient votes for passage and he won't move a bill until he can count enough positive votes. Reid understands very clearly that any vote to expand background checks would pose a huge political problem for vulnerable red-state Democrats seeking reelection this year.

6- Gun Business Is Booming, Pt. II

The lamestream media told you:
The lamestream media told you:

The recovery is slow, the economy is slow, business is slow, jobs are slow, but at least inflation is slow.



The Uninvited Ombudsman notes however that:
The Uninvited Ombudsman notes however that:

The economic impact of the firearms and ammunition industry in the U.S. has nearly doubled in the past five years, figures from the National Shooting Sports Foundation show. The lamestream media has in large measure missed the story for five years.

The total economic impact of the industry increased from $19.1 billion in 2008 to $37.7 billion in 2013, a 97%. The total number of full-time equivalent jobs rose from more than 166,000 to more than 245,000, a 48% increase in that five-year period

Stephen Sanetti, NSSF President and CEO, said, "While our nation's overall economic recovery has been slow since 2008, our industry has been a true bright spot, increasing our direct workforce by nearly half, adding jobs that pay an average of more than $47,700 in wages and benefits."

The Firearms and Ammunition Industry Economic Impact Report: 2013 provides a state-by-state breakdown of job numbers, wages and output covering direct, supplier and induced employment, as well as federal excise taxes paid. Some highlights, details (and statutes) included in the 8th edition:

--Mandatory carry-license training has been reduced from 10-15 hours to 4-6 hours.
  Widely publicized by the "news" media. Your need-to-know hasn't dropped, just the government mandate.

--Renewals are now a paperwork and taxing process that can be concluded online, with no new testing required.
   Savvy instructors will start promoting training instead of waiting for expired-license students to show up. Some instructors think this means the end of their business, and for some that may be true. For others, business will increase, as training becomes demand driven instead of government mandated. In Arizona, this demographic and market shift led to new ranges and new training companies opening, catering to newcomers, plus advanced tactical and refresher classes. The ease of renewals led to more original signups.

--Instructors no longer go to the DPS range for testing, they now test each other at a range of their own choosing.

--The risk CHLs used to face for having a gun momentarily show through concealment has been reduced, not eliminated.

--The guarantees of the Motorist Protection Act have been extended somewhat to colleges and universities. It is a step toward Constitutional Carry -- true freedom to carry, without requiring government-issued permission slips.

--The preemption law got some teeth, and BB and air guns are now defined and included.

--Hotels that want to ban your civil right to arms must give you notice or face (minor) criminal penalties.

--A program to provide armed guards in schools ("School Marshals") is underway, though it will be a while before it is robust. Not exactly part of the CHL program, DPS wants other dept. to run it, must have CHL to apply, psych test and a lot more to it. See the book for details.

--The abusive policy of destroying firearms in police custody has ended. Those guns must now be sold, the money used to fight crime.

--The artificial "SA" and "NSA" distinction between semi-autos and non-semi-autos has been discarded. Minimum caliber for the shooting test remains .32, but any qualification allows you to carry any legal firearm, and qualify once in a lifetime (for now).

--Using your social security number for identification in the CHL program is now banned. But forms still have it included.
